number(n,m)中n表示这个数有效位是多少位;m表示这个数的小数位数或整数位数,m<0,表示的就是整数位数,m>0表示的就是小数位数 怎么表示负数我还不会
在大多数情况下,相同的标识符名称可以用于不同类型的SQL实体; 例如,一个模式、该模式中的表以及该...
sql查询表N到M行的数据,查询表内最新标识列 第一比较傻的方法 select * from (select top (m-n+1) * from (select top m * from 表) a order by a.Id desc) b order by b.Id 第二有技术含量的方法 select * from (select *,ROW_NUMBER() over (order by id)px from 表)as t where px>...
我们首先来说一说 limit n,m是怎么回事,首先它要获取到第一个参数游标n的位置,那么它就必须得扫描到n的位置,接着从此位置起往后取m条数据,不足m条的返回实际的数量。那么这就会有一个性能的问题,当游标的数值越来越大时性能就会越来越差。 例如: 我们先创建用户表,再使用plsql插入100万数据: 代码语言:javasc...
sql server 一对多 m对n sql一对多例子 1. 概述 项目开发中,在进行数据库表结构设计时,会根据业务需求及业务模块之间的关系,分析并设计表结构,由于 业务之间相互关联,所以各个表结构之间也存在着各种联系,基本上分为三种: 一对多(多对一) 多对多 一对一...
sql server求整数m除以n的余数 sql语言怎么求余数,集合在数据库领域表示记录的集合。SQL是一门面向集合的语言,四则运算里的和、差、积已经加入到标准SQL,但由于其标准化进程比较缓慢,一些集合运算在主流的数据库如MySQL、HiveSQL中还未实现。本节给大家介绍,SQL中集合
在MySQL中,可以使用Limit语句来查询第m行到第n行的记录,例如:select*fromtablenamelimitm,n。然而,在SQLServer中,不直接支持Limit语句。在这种情况下,可以利用TOP关键字实现类似功能。以SQLServer2005为例,假设我们使用AdventureWorks作为测试数据库,如果要查询id列前6条记录,相应的SQL语句如下:selec...
取n到m条的语句为: select*from#tempwhereid0>=nandid0<=m 如果你在执行selectidentity(int)id0,*into#tempfromtablename这条语句的时候报错,那是因为你的DB中间的selectinto/bulkcopy属性没有打开要先执行: execsp_dboption你的DB名字,'selectinto/bulkcopy',true ...
SQL Server中的"LIMIT"功能类似于其他数据库系统中的分页查询,用于限制返回的数据行数。以下是如何在SQL Server中实现这个功能的直观解释:首先,创建一个名为"nubers"的测试表,只包含一列并填充数字1到35。这个表是为了演示LIMIT的用法。当我们尝试使用LIMIT语句,如"SELECT * FROM nubers LIMIT 10,1...
--从TABLE表中取出第m到n条记录 (Exists版本) SELECTTOPn-m+1*FROMTABLEASaWHERENotExists (Select*From(SelectTopm-1*FromTABLEorderbyid) bWhereb.id=a.id ) Orderbyid --m为上标,n为下标,例如取出第8到12条记录,m=8,n=12,Table为表名